什么是SUMIF函数?
在使用Excel进行数据分析时,条件求和是一个非常常见的操作。SUMIF函数正是为这种需求设计的,它能够根据指定的条件对数据区域中的某些数值进行求和。无论是统计销售业绩、计算部门预算,还是进行数据筛选,SUMIF函数都是一个非常有用的工具。
SUMIF函数的基本语法
要在Excel中使用SUMIF函数,需要掌握其基本语法。SUMIF函数的标准语法如下:
SUMIF(range, criteria, [sum_range])
参数解析
在这条语法中,有三个关键的参数:
range:这是你想要应用条件的单元格范围。
criteria:这是用来定义条件的文本或表达式。
sum_range(可选):这是需要求和的实际数据单元格范围。如果忽略此参数,Excel将对range参数指定的单元格范围进行求和。
SUMIF函数的基本示例
通过一个简单的例子来说明SUMIF函数的应用:
示例1:简单的条件求和
假设你有一个包含销售数据的表格,其中列A是销售员的姓名,列B是销售金额。现在你想计算销售员“张三”所销售的总金额。你可以使用SUMIF函数:
=SUMIF(A:A, "张三", B:B)
示例2:使用条件表达式
如果你想计算销售金额大于1000的总金额,可以这样写:
=SUMIF(B:B, ">1000")
SUMIF函数的高级应用
为了更好地使用SUMIF函数,你还可以结合其他函数和复杂的条件进行高级应用。
示例3:与其它函数组合
假设你想使用SUMIF函数计算大于某个单元格值的总金额,可以结合其他函数实现,比如:假设单元格D1中存储了参考值1000:
=SUMIF(B:B, ">" & D1)
示例4:多条件求和
Excel还提供了SUMIFS函数来处理多条件的求和需求。假设你不仅想知道销售员“张三”的销售总额,还想限定日期在某个范围内,例如日期在2023年1月1日到2023年12月31日之间,可以使用SUMIFS函数:
=SUMIFS(B:B, A:A, "张三", C:C, ">2023-01-01", C:C, "<2023-12-31")
常见错误及其解决方法
在使用SUMIF函数时,有时可能会遇到一些常见错误,这里列出一些常见问题及其解决方法。
错误1:#VALUE!错误
如果SUMIF函数的条件格式不正确,可能会导致#VALUE!错误。例如,如果误用的条件是文本而不是数值:
=SUMIF(B:B, ">text")
解决方法:确认条件的格式是否正确。
错误2:#NAME?错误
如果拼写错误或函数名称错误,可能会导致#NAME?错误。例如,拼写了”SUMIF“为”SUMIFF“:
=SUMIFF(A:A, "张三", B:B)
解决方法:检查函数名称是否正确。
结论
SUMIF函数是Excel中非常强大且实用的函数,能够根据指定条件快速对数据进行求和。掌握其基本语法和常见应用方法,可以让我们在数据分析过程中事半功倍。同时,注意避免常见错误,确保结果的准确性。